Laser Operator/ Programmer

Responsibilities
Operators are responsible for set-up and operation of laser cutting machines to produce products meeting customer quality requirements. Operators must also operate and process parts according to print and traveler requirements. Operators must monitor machine cutting performance and utilization.
- Able to program on and offline (Tru Tops, Catia) for the Trumpf laser
- Understands machine setup including the following: program retrieval & editing, proper gases, proper nozzles, and materials.
- Understanding of start-up and shut down for Trumpf laser machines.
- Diagnose machining problems while performing jobs, making modifications as needed.
- Able to perform laser cutting operations efficiently and effectively, according to Work Instructions.
- Able to check Quality of product machined and notify supervisor of process issues.
- Maintain safe operations by adhering to safety procedures and regulations.
- Perform preventative maintenance and housekeeping per established schedules.
- Other duties as assigned
Job Requirements/Preferred
- Ability to read blueprints a must
- Ability to follow and complete daily production schedules
- Trumpf Laser Experience is a must.
- 2-5 years’ experience working in a manufacturing environment.
- Ability to use basic math to analyze information and measuring equipment.
- Additional courses in Laser set-up and operation.
- Experience with Rotary Cutting
- Good attendance.
- Ability to work safely and efficiently.
- Ability to work with close tolerances.
- Ability to work in a team and independently.
- Strong attention to detail and ability to follow instruction and written processes.
- High School Diploma or Equivalent
Equipment: Laser machines, micrometers, calipers, height gauges, and other inspection equipment as required.
